**Ticket: Dark-mode config drift on Ledgerline admin**

Welcome aboard — quick context: the Ledgerline admin dashboard's dark-mode flags differ between prod and staging. Staging has the new theme tokens enabled; prod still serves the legacy palette, so screenshots in docs don't match. We need to align them before the next release. The values currently live in production are listed below.

settings of bawif-fawif:
ralix:
  log_level: warn
  metrics_host: metrics.ralix.tolvaqsys.internal
  pool_size: 32

**Ticket: Crash-report vault locked — Shatterline pipeline**

The secrets vault feeding the Shatterline crash-report ingester locked itself after a node reimage, so symbolication keys are unreachable and reports are piling up unprocessed. Maintainers: unlock via the recovery flow, then restart the ingest workers. For reference going forward, the vault's recovery passphrase is:

strongbox words: gilok-druion-briath-wendor-briion-prawyn-fenion-oliir-casdor-holius-briius-gilath-gilael-pelys

Handover: template rendering performance (Larkspur)

Hi Tomas — passing this to you for review. The slow renders traced back to the partial cache being invalidated on every locale switch, so high-traffic pages were recompiling templates constantly. My branch keys the cache by locale and trims the template AST before caching, which cut p95 render time roughly in half on staging. Watch for memory growth with many locales; I added a cap but it's a guess. Benchmark methodology and raw numbers are on the internal results page.

operations page: https://jenkins.zemvarcloud.local/job/merge_requests/repo/build/73930b4b30f0a8ed

Visitors may not enter the evacuation-chair store on Level 3 of Dunmore Court unaccompanied. A Rellick Group fire marshal must be present. New starters: know its location, don't block the door, report missing chairs at once. Marshals opening the store during drills should use the keypad code below.

badge for hahif-faweg: bdg-VF-9